Luis Muñoz takes a journey back to his childhood

The Málaga CF central defender visited his former school, CEIP Ramón Simonet within the ‘Blue and Whites’ Values’ campaign. He was welcomed to rapturous applause from the excited young fans.

Almost a decade after he left, Luis Muñoz returned to his school to take part in a very special class of ‘Blue and Whites’ Values’, alongside the MCF Foundation. The player greeted his former teachers, took photos with the students and stepped on to the former sports ground where he first started playing football. His younger sister, who studies at the same school, greatly enjoyed Luis Muñoz’s visit.

With a smile from ear to ear, the Blue and Whites’ central defender answered the pupils’ questions, and highlighted the importance of values in sport: “It’s an honour to come to my school representing Málaga. My little sister is also studying here. I didn’t expect such a wonderful welcome. I’m delighted. My advice to them is to ensure they eat healthily, and get along with everyone. They must give their all and always set goals to achieve”.

Málaga CF femenino coach, Raúl Iznata was in charge of giving the #BlueandWhitesValues talk to the students, accompanied by Sebastián Fernández Reyes ‘Basti from the Foundation’s Social Department, and women’s team goalkeeper, Chelsea Louis Ashurst.
